Ingredients for Creamy Hot Cocoa
Gather these items:
- 2 Tablespoons light brown sugar (firmly packed)
- 1 Tablespoon natural cocoa powder
- Pinch of table salt (about 1/16th teaspoon)
- ¾ cup milk (divided)
- ¼ cup heavy cream (may substitute with more milk)
- ¼ teaspoon vanilla extract
How to Make Creamy Hot Cocoa Step-by-Step
- Step 1: In a small saucepan, combine the light brown sugar, natural cocoa powder, and a pinch of salt. Whisk these ingredients together thoroughly.
- Step 2: Pour in approximately 2-3 tablespoons of milk and whisk until the mixture becomes smooth.
- Step 3: Place the saucepan over low heat. Keep whisking until the sugar starts to melt and the mixture darkens.
- Step 4: Gradually add the remaining milk and heavy cream. Continue whisking until it is steaming hot.
- Step 5: Remove from heat and stir in the vanilla extract. Pour into a heatproof mug and serve warm.

How to Store and Reheat Creamy Hot Cocoa
For any leftovers, simply store your creamy hot cocoa in an airtight container in the fridge. To reheat, warm it gently over low heat on the stovetop, stirring until heated through. This recipe takes only 12 minutes total, so it’s perfect for meal prep!
Frequently Asked Questions About Creamy Hot Cocoa
What’s the secret to perfect Creamy Hot Cocoa?
The secret lies in using high-quality cocoa powder and balancing the sweetness with a pinch of salt. This enhances the rich hot chocolate flavor, making it truly decadent.
Can I make Creamy Hot Cocoa 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are this cozy drink ahead and store it in the fridge. Just reheat and enjoy whenever you need a comforting creamy chocolate drink.
How do I avoid common mistakes with Creamy Hot Cocoa?
To avoid clumps, ensure you whisk the cocoa powder and sugar into a paste with a bit of milk before heating. This helps create a smooth hot chocolate mix.
